// NsenterMounter is part of experimental support for running the kubelet
|
||||||
|
// in a container. Currently, all docker containers receive their own mount
|
||||||
|
// namespaces. NsenterMounter works by executing nsenter to run commands in
|
||||||
|
// the host's mount namespace.
|
||||||
|
//
|
||||||
|
// NsenterMounter requires:
|
||||||
|
//
|
||||||
|
// 1. Docker >= 1.6 due to the dependency on the slave propagation mode
|
||||||
|
// of the bind-mount of the kubelet root directory in the container.
|
||||||
|
// Docker 1.5 used a private propagation mode for bind-mounts, so mounts
|
||||||
|
// performed in the host's mount namespace do not propagate out to the
|
||||||
|
// bind-mount in this docker version.
|
||||||
|
// 2. The host's root filesystem must be available at /rootfs
|
||||||
|
// 3. The nsenter binary must be at /nsenter in the container's filesystem.
|
||||||
|
// 4. The Kubelet process must have CAP_SYS_ADMIN (required by nsenter); at
|
||||||
|
// the present, this effectively means that the kubelet is running in a
|
||||||
|
// privileged container.
|
||||||
|
//
|
||||||
|
// For more information about mount propagation modes, see:
|
||||||
|
// https://www.kernel.org/doc/Documentation/filesystems/sharedsubtree.txt
